Comptech is the most moddest sound of all.. zippy, aggresive, and humble... there are now a lot of choices though.. listed from loudest to quietest

1) Greddy EVO2
2) ATLP Non-Res Quads, Base or XLR8 Non-Res Quads, or Dual
3) ATLP Res Quads, Base or XLR Res Quads, or Dual
4) Comptech or Tanabe
5) Custom Modded Stock Exhaust
